Local Directions: Located on Highway 395 on the northwest end of Lee Vining. Coming from the north we are the first business on the right, from the south we are just past the Chevron gas station on the left. Use the entrance off highway 395. Please do not use Beaver's Lane entrance as you would be facing the incorrect way!

Mean, rude, unprofessional, no refunds, double booking, cash only
Rebbie
Newbie
July 22, 2020
I gave this location several 1 star reviews because the facilities are nice for many reasons. However, my experience was poor. The staff was curt and cold. Their website is vague and missing a lot of information. When I emailed questions, even though they did answer them, it seemed as if I was a burden. Upon checking in the next morning, the man did not acknowledge me nor looked at me and the woman seemed annoyed with my presence. It was as if they were angry I was even there. They only take cash payments. I was so put off by their treatment of me, we found another site for two nights. They refused to refund us even though they were renting our already paid spot to additional guests - so, they were charging two guests for the site when only one was staying there. They put my reservation and night check-in envelope in the wrong name. It is not possible to get someone to communicate with outside of 8am-5pm. They require full payment up front or threaten to give your space away and refuse refunds. They demanded to have their shower tokens back even though they would not refund me for two nights I did not stay there and rented my already paid spot out to other guests. So, we stayed at another campground and went back to take our showers there and refill our water containers in the process. I threw the other remaining tokens in the trash. I have never been treated this way at any establishment.
